Abstract

The invention discloses a turnover tool for a gearbox, which comprises a support bracket and a rotary body, wherein the support bracket is provided with a left bracket and a right bracket which are arranged correspondingly; a left support hole is formed on the upper part of the left bracket, a right support hole is formed on the right bracket, and center lines of the left and right support holes are arranged coaxially; the rotary body is rotationally arranged on the support bracket, and both ends of the rotary body are respectively connected with the left and right support holes; the gearbox is detachably connected on the rotary body, and can rotate with the rotary body. By the tool, the gearbox can be convenient to turn in an assembly process, and thus, the labor intensity of workers is relieved.

Description

technical field [0001] The invention relates to a gear box overturning tool, which is suitable for the overturning of a gear box, especially a gear box of an electric locomotive during the assembly process. Background technique [0002] The gearbox of the railway locomotive needs to be turned over during the assembly process. The traditional way of turning over the gearbox is mainly to be turned over by the operator manually. [0003] Since the traditional gearbox is mainly a thin-walled steel plate welded structure, its weight is relatively light, so it is relatively convenient to turn the gearbox manually during the assembly process. [0004] However, with the high-speed and heavy-duty requirements of the railway, the structure of the gearbox of the freight locomotive is mainly cast from cast iron materials, and the wall of the gearbox of the cast structure is thicker, so that its weight is more than 400 kg, even if it is a half box.
